Starting Point: Locorotondo’s Historic Center

The tour kicks off in the heart of Locorotondo, a town renowned for its circular layout and elegant architecture. Walking through the narrow streets, you’ll admire portals of buildings, arches, and panoramic viewpoints that showcase the town’s beauty. This is a perfect way to get a feel for the town’s refined charm. Visitors say Rocco, the guide, makes the history come alive without overwhelming—he’s friendly, knowledgeable, and patient.

One highlight is passing by the church of San Giorgio, a building that stands out for its simple elegance. Just across the street, you’ll notice the embroidery rose window of Madonna della Greca, which many find visually striking. The local Palazzo Morelli exudes an air of old-world sophistication, rounding out the first stop’s mix of history and beauty.

Cycling to the Panoramic Vantage Point

Leaving the historic center, the group heads to Lungovalle – Via Nardelli for a quick five-minute ride to a panorama that offers sweeping views of the Itria Valley. This is a highlight for photographers and landscape lovers alike—imagine rolling hills dotted with vineyards and the iconic trulli. Many reviews specifically praise how Rocco’s storytelling makes this scenery come alive, pointing out details you’d miss on your own.

Martina Franca’s Elegant Old Town

Next, the group pedals into the refined streets of Martina Franca, famous for its baroque architecture and lively atmosphere. Riding through its elegant alleys, you’ll see the Doges Palace, which impresses with an imposing façade. The streets are lively but manageable—perfect for a leisurely walk and discovery. The ice cream break here is a real treat, giving you a chance to relax and savor a homemade scoop—a favorite among previous travelers.

Visiting Basilica di San Martino

The tour winds down at the Basilica of San Martino, a basilica with a façade decorated with intricate details. It’s a sight that calls for a few photos. You’ll also get a chance to check the sundial on the clock tower—a fun, tiny puzzle to test your time-telling skills, as some reviews note.
